Qatar and Ecuador maintain diplomatic relations supported by resident embassies in Doha and Quito. In recent years the two countries have worked to broaden economic ties, with discussions covering areas such as trade and investment, energy, mining and infrastructure, and Ecuador has expressed interest in attracting Qatari investment while exploring opportunities in the Qatari market.
Bilateral engagement has included high-level exchanges and rounds of political consultations between the two foreign ministries, as both sides seek to enhance political dialogue and cooperation in fields of mutual benefit.
